A tourist has died in Paris from the coronavirus – the first person to be killed by the deadly virus in Europe.
The 80-year-old Chinese man died after spending two weeks in intensive care in the French capital – bringing the frightful death toll to 1,527.
French Health Minister Agnes Buzyn confirmed he had passed away this morning – and revealed the man’s daughter had also been treated.
